Renowned journalist Alex Chamwada devoted his weekend to reconnecting with a significant figure from his past: his former high school headteacher, Mr. Ijait Aluku, in Lugari Sub-County, Kakamega County.
Chamwada shared a photo of his touching reunion with his esteemed teacher back at St. Peter’s Mumias High School.
The esteemed scribe accompanied the new photo with an old one, throwing back 35 years to a day when he was receiving an award from Mr. Ijait during a school assembly.

The throwback photo depicts a youthful and inspired Chamwada, clad in navy blue shorts, a green pullover, and a crisp white shirt.
“Visited my former headteacher, St. Peter’s Mumias High School, Mr. Ijait Aluku at his home in Lugari today. Compare and contrast the photos. Then and now. In the first photo I’m receiving an award from Mr. Aluku during a school assembly. 35 years ago,” he posted on his Facebook page.
